        //
        // Emits the right opcode to load from an array
        //
        public void EmitArrayLoad(ArrayContainer ac)
        {
            if (ac.Rank > 1)
            {
                if (IsAnonymousStoreyMutateRequired)
                {
                    ac = (ArrayContainer)ac.Mutate(CurrentAnonymousMethod.Storey.Mutator);
                }

                ig.Emit(OpCodes.Call, ac.GetGetMethod());
                return;
            }


            var type = ac.Element;

            if (type.Kind == MemberKind.Enum)
            {
                type = EnumSpec.GetUnderlyingType(type);
            }

            switch (type.BuiltinType)
            {
            case BuiltinTypeSpec.Type.Bool:
            //
            // bool array can actually store any byte value in underlying byte slot
            // and C# spec does not specify any normalization rule, except the result
            // is undefined
            //
            case BuiltinTypeSpec.Type.Byte:
                ig.Emit(OpCodes.Ldelem_U1);
                break;

            case BuiltinTypeSpec.Type.SByte:
                ig.Emit(OpCodes.Ldelem_I1);
                break;

            case BuiltinTypeSpec.Type.Short:
                ig.Emit(OpCodes.Ldelem_I2);
                break;

            case BuiltinTypeSpec.Type.UShort:
            case BuiltinTypeSpec.Type.Char:
                ig.Emit(OpCodes.Ldelem_U2);
                break;

            case BuiltinTypeSpec.Type.Int:
                ig.Emit(OpCodes.Ldelem_I4);
                break;

            case BuiltinTypeSpec.Type.UInt:
                ig.Emit(OpCodes.Ldelem_U4);
                break;

            case BuiltinTypeSpec.Type.ULong:
            case BuiltinTypeSpec.Type.Long:
                ig.Emit(OpCodes.Ldelem_I8);
                break;

            case BuiltinTypeSpec.Type.Float:
                ig.Emit(OpCodes.Ldelem_R4);
                break;

            case BuiltinTypeSpec.Type.Double:
                ig.Emit(OpCodes.Ldelem_R8);
                break;

            case BuiltinTypeSpec.Type.IntPtr:
                ig.Emit(OpCodes.Ldelem_I);
                break;

            default:
                switch (type.Kind)
                {
                case MemberKind.Struct:
                    if (IsAnonymousStoreyMutateRequired)
                    {
                        type = CurrentAnonymousMethod.Storey.Mutator.Mutate(type);
                    }

                    ig.Emit(OpCodes.Ldelema, type.GetMetaInfo());
                    ig.Emit(OpCodes.Ldobj, type.GetMetaInfo());
                    break;

                case MemberKind.TypeParameter:
                    if (IsAnonymousStoreyMutateRequired)
                    {
                        type = CurrentAnonymousMethod.Storey.Mutator.Mutate(type);
                    }

                    ig.Emit(OpCodes.Ldelem, type.GetMetaInfo());
                    break;

                case MemberKind.PointerType:
                    ig.Emit(OpCodes.Ldelem_I);
                    break;

                default:
                    ig.Emit(OpCodes.Ldelem_Ref);
                    break;
                }
                break;
            }
        }

        //
        // Emits the right opcode to load from an array
        //
        public void EmitArrayLoad(ArrayContainer ac)
        {
            if (ac.Rank > 1)
            {
                if (IsAnonymousStoreyMutateRequired)
                {
                    ac = (ArrayContainer)ac.Mutate(CurrentAnonymousMethod.Storey.Mutator);
                }

                ig.Emit(OpCodes.Call, ac.GetGetMethod());
                return;
            }

            var type = ac.Element;

            if (TypeManager.IsEnumType(type))
            {
                type = EnumSpec.GetUnderlyingType(type);
            }

            if (type == TypeManager.byte_type || type == TypeManager.bool_type)
            {
                Emit(OpCodes.Ldelem_U1);
            }
            else if (type == TypeManager.sbyte_type)
            {
                Emit(OpCodes.Ldelem_I1);
            }
            else if (type == TypeManager.short_type)
            {
                Emit(OpCodes.Ldelem_I2);
            }
            else if (type == TypeManager.ushort_type || type == TypeManager.char_type)
            {
                Emit(OpCodes.Ldelem_U2);
            }
            else if (type == TypeManager.int32_type)
            {
                Emit(OpCodes.Ldelem_I4);
            }
            else if (type == TypeManager.uint32_type)
            {
                Emit(OpCodes.Ldelem_U4);
            }
            else if (type == TypeManager.uint64_type)
            {
                Emit(OpCodes.Ldelem_I8);
            }
            else if (type == TypeManager.int64_type)
            {
                Emit(OpCodes.Ldelem_I8);
            }
            else if (type == TypeManager.float_type)
            {
                Emit(OpCodes.Ldelem_R4);
            }
            else if (type == TypeManager.double_type)
            {
                Emit(OpCodes.Ldelem_R8);
            }
            else if (type == TypeManager.intptr_type)
            {
                Emit(OpCodes.Ldelem_I);
            }
            else if (TypeManager.IsStruct(type))
            {
                Emit(OpCodes.Ldelema, type);
                Emit(OpCodes.Ldobj, type);
            }
            else if (type.IsGenericParameter)
            {
                Emit(OpCodes.Ldelem, type);
            }
            else if (type.IsPointer)
            {
                Emit(OpCodes.Ldelem_I);
            }
            else
            {
                Emit(OpCodes.Ldelem_Ref);
            }
        }
